Time to jazz things up and Sarah’s Jazz Club has several groovy nights of music coming up this month. Bringing that ‘smoky jazz bar’ vibe to Nicosia – minus the indoor smoking – two live music events are on this weekend and even more the following week.

On Friday, the new ensemble Bebop-Aloola will bring the jumping sounds of bebop to the jazz bar. Including Sarah herself on vocals, the ensemble is a get-together of some of the island’s most well-known jazz musicians: Dimitris Miaris on piano, Marios Spyrou on drums and Costas Challoumas on bass. Starting at 9.30pm, Friday’s performance will be all about this lively jazz style.

Bebop developed in the early 1940s and is most closely linked with Dizzy Gillespie, Charlie Parker and Thelonius Monk. While it is mostly a fast-paced, euphoric experience, Bebop is also associated with soul-moving ballads and that’s what the Bepop-Aloola ensemble hopes to bring.

Then on Saturday, the Marios Toumbas Trio will play pure jazz sounds. Described as one of the best jazz pianists on the island, Toumbas returns to Sarah’s Jazz Club with Michael Messios on bass and Elias Ioannou on trumpet. Toumbas has performed at prestigious concerts in many countries abroad and all round Cyprus. “Recognised for his influential and skilful playing,” say Saturday’s organisers, “audiences love Marios Toumbas for the swing and improvisation in his solos and sensitive arranging of jazz standards.”

Next week, the Nicosia jazz bar will host US trumpet player John Marshall who is coming to Cyprus to perform for the very first time. Local band Workin’ Trio will accompany him as he tours Cyprus and at Sarah’s Jazz Club, they will perform twice – on October 28 and 29.

Closing off the month at the Jazz Club is a performance by the Ioanna Troullidou Trio on October 30. With Ioanna on vocals, Toumbas on piano and Irenaeos Koullouras on double bass, the band will perform various songs from the different decades of jazz music. From jazz standards to bebop jazz composition as well as some original songs composed by Ioanna. The music will again begin at 9.30pm for another evening of quality jazz before November’s events take over.
